Agartala, April 12: In a coordinated effort, Assam Rifles and the Directorate of Revenue Intelligence (DRI) successfully intercepted and confiscated 62 kilograms of ganja. The operation unfolded after receiving intelligence on Thursday night regarding a significant stash of ganja concealed in the Krishna Tula area of Sepahijala district.

The joint operation, meticulously planned based on this classified information, culminated in the seizure of the illicit substance. The estimated market value of the seized ganja stands at ₹27.9 lakh.
